About Network Scanner App for MAC
Network Scanner is a fast, highly configurable IPv4/IPv6 scanner that can streamline many of your network support procedures. Its well-designed interface, light weight and portability coupled with an extensive range of options and advanced features make Network Scanner an invaluable tool, whether you are a professional system administrator, someone providing occasional network maintenance, or a general user interested in computer security.
SoftPerfect Network Scanner can ping computers, scan ports, discover shared folders and retrieve practically any information about network devices via WMI, SNMP, HTTP, SSH and PowerShell. It also scans for remote services, registry, files and performance counters; offers flexible filtering and display options and exports NetScan results to a variety of formats from XML to JSON.
Key features:
- Fully supports both IPv4 and IPv6 discovery
- Performs a ping sweep and displays live devices
- Detects hardware MAC-addresses, even across routers
- Discovers writable and hidden shared folders
- Detects internal and external IP addresses
- Retrieves any system information via WMI, remote registry, file system and service manager
- Scans for listening TCP ports, some UDP and SNMP services
- Retrieves currently logged-on users, configured user accounts, uptime, etc
- Supports remote SSH, PowerShell and VBScript command execution
- Launches external third party applications
- Supports Wake-On-LAN, remote shutdown and sending network messages
- Exports results to HTML, XML, JSON, CSV and TXT
- Integrates with Nmap for OS discovery, vulnerability tests, and much more
- Can be run from a USB flash drive without installation
New Features
Version 8.1:
- Added: WS-Discovery support to locate services in a local network.
- Added: separate setting for maximum number of threads in live display.
- Added: scan result export to SQLite database for further processing.
- Improved: UPnP discovery allows to scan detected devices and shows device type.
- Improved: scanning for shares on macOS detects disk space, writability and security.
- Fixed: filter display in the recent list if only one filter was defined.
- Fixed: applications sorting order when a new item is added.
- Fixed: resolution of non-ASCII computer names.
Installing Apps on MAC
Most Mac OS applications downloaded from outside the App Store come inside a DMG file. Like if you wanna download Network Scanner for mac from this page, you’ll directly get the .dmg installation file into your MAC.
- First, download the Network Scanner .dmg installation file from the official link on above
- Double-click the DMG file to open it, and you’ll see a Finder window.
- Often these will include the application itself, some form of arrow, and a shortcut to the Applications folder.
- Simply drag the application’s icon to your Applications folder
- And you’re done: the Network Scanner is now installed.
- When you’re done installing: just click the “Eject” arrow.
- Then you can feel free to delete the original DMG file: you don’t need it anymore.
- Now, enjoy Network Scanner for MAC !
You don’t have to put your programs in the Applications folder, though: they’ll run from anywhere. Some people create a “Games” directory, to keep games separate from other applications. But Applications is the most convenient place to put things, so we suggest you just put everything there.
DMG files are mounted by your system, like a sort of virtual hard drive. When you’re done installing the application, it’s a good idea to unmount the DMG in Finder.
